Security Engineer, Agentic AI & Identity

$104,959–$157,438 year

On-siteMount Laurel, New Jersey, United States

Full TimeEnterprise

Job Summary

Architect, deploy, and maintain Microsoft Entra ID Conditional Access Policies, including risk-based access controls, workload identities, and Zero Trust security controls. Develop and manage secure identity solutions for users, applications, APIs, workloads, and AI agents across hybrid and multi-cloud environments. Design and implement Agent Identity frameworks utilizing Agent IDs, Workload Identity Federation, SPIFFE/SPIRE, and machine-to-machine authentication mechanisms. Partner with security, platform, and application teams to integrate identity controls into Agentic AI solutions leveraging MCP, RAG, and LLMs. Establish and enforce Zero Trust security principles across enterprise applications, APIs, cloud workloads, and AI-driven systems. Evaluate, troubleshoot, and resolve complex authentication, authorization, federation, and application access issues across enterprise environments. Implement IAM automation and operational efficiencies through PowerShell, Python, Microsoft Graph APIs, and Terraform. Collaborate with cloud engineering teams to integrate identity platforms across Azure, AWS, and GCP environments. Create technical documentation, workflows, architecture diagrams, and knowledge articles using Markdown and Mermaid. Monitor emerging technologies within Identity Security and Agentic AI, driving adoption of innovative capabilities. Participate in security reviews, threat modeling exercises, and architecture governance processes to ensure compliance with enterprise security requirements.
